Securing a Spanish National Student Visa for International Students

Pursuing higher education in Spain is an attractive prospect for international students seeking a rich cultural experience and a world-renowned educational system. To study in Spain, you'll need to apply a Spanish National Student Visa, which allows you to reside and study within the country. The process involves several steps and requirements. Firstly, ensure your chosen educational institution is officially recognized by the Spanish Ministry of Education. Next, gather all necessary documents, including your copyright, academic transcripts, proof of financial means, a letter of acceptance from your university, and a completed copyright form.

  • File your application to the Spanish Embassy or Consulate in your home country well in advance of your intended departure date.
  • Attend a visa interview if necessary.
  • Prepare all supporting documents, such as health insurance coverage and proof of language proficiency.

Upon successful acceptance, you'll receive your student visa, allowing you to enter Spain and begin your educational journey.
